What is a Giclee ?
Giclee is french term meaning "to spray". a Giclee is a reproduction or a print ( whether it is a "Paper Giclee" or a "Canvas Giclee" ) that was digitally printed with a computerized printer. The giclee process is of very high quality and exceeds other traditional methods of printmaking.

The image is not computer generated - the image of the print is painted by hand by an artist and that original painting is then scanned at a very high resolution ( very high detail ) and transferred to the computer where the image is processed to then send that information to the printer where the printer then begins to print the image onto the particular material whether it be canvas or paper. The inks used in authentic Giclee printing are UV inhibiting inks ( resist fading caused by the sun or interior lighting ) and the papers and canvases are acid free to prevent yellowing of the image in the future.
